Basement wall repair services involve assessing and fixing issues related to the structural integrity of basement walls. Over time, basement walls can develop cracks, bowing, or shifting due to various factors such as soil pressure, moisture intrusion, or temperature changes. Professional contractors typically evaluate the extent of damage and determine the appropriate repair methods, which may include wall reinforcement, crack sealing, or the installation of wall braces. These repairs are designed to stabilize the walls, prevent further deterioration, and help maintain the safety and value of the property.

Many common problems prompt homeowners to seek basement wall repair services. Cracks in basement walls can allow water to seep in, leading to moisture issues and potential mold growth. Bowing or bulging walls often indicate pressure from the surrounding soil, which can threaten the foundation’s stability. In some cases, walls may shift or settle unevenly, causing uneven floors or structural concerns. Addressing these issues early with professional repair services can help prevent more costly damage and preserve the foundation’s strength over time.

The overview below groups typical Basement Wall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or issues like small cracks or sealing leaks,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, making it a common cost band for basic work.

Moderate Repairs - Larger repairs such as significant crack repairs or partial wall stabilization usually range from $600 to $2,000. These projects are more involved but still fall within a middle cost tier for many homeowners.

Full Wall Restoration - Complete repairs of damaged basement walls, including extensive crack filling and reinforcement, can cost between $2,000 and $5,000. Fewer projects reach into this higher range, which is typical for more comprehensive work.

Full Wall Replacement - Replacing entire basement walls due to severe damage or failure can range from $5,000 to $15,000 or more. These larger, more complex projects are less common but necessary in serious cases of structural concern.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of basement wall damage? Indicators include visible cracks, bowing or bulging walls, water seepage, and uneven floors that may suggest the need for repair services.

How do local contractors typically repair basement walls? They may use methods such as wall reinforcement, crack injection, waterproofing, or foundation underpinning to stabilize and restore basement walls.

Can basement wall repairs prevent future issues? Proper repairs can help address current damage and reduce the risk of further deterioration, but ongoing maintenance and monitoring are recommended.

What types of materials are used in basement wall repair? Common materials include epoxy or polyurethane injections, carbon fiber reinforcement, and waterproof sealants tailored to the specific repair needs.
